A note on how to make sure your White Collar RPF is included in the newsletter:
  • Dreamwidth: Post your fanwork to a searchable journal or community with the words white collar in the title or body of the post
  • Archive of Our Own: Post your fanwork with the tag White Collar RPF
  • Livejournal: Unfortunately we cannot link to fanworks posted to the member-locked community [info]wc_rps. Therefore we ask you to post your work to your own unlocked journal and comment to the newsletter with a link.
  • Fanfiction.net: Real Person Fiction may not be posted to fanfiction.net
